Grasping Online Casino Security: How Encryption Secures Your Data

Encryption functions as a vital safeguard for players' sensitive data in the realm of online casinos. By changing data into a code that can only be decoded by authorized parties, encryption ensures that personal and financial details remain confidential during online transactions. This process typically employs advanced algorithms, such as AES (Advanced Encryption Standard), which create a secure connection between the user's device and the casino's servers.

When gamblers submit sensitive information, like credit card details or personal identification, encryption protects against potential interception by cybercriminals. It serves as a barrier, stopping unauthorized access and guarding against identity theft and fraud. Credible online casinos prominently display security measures, including encryption certificates, to ensure players of their commitment to data protection. Thus, understanding the role of encryption in online casino security is crucial for players seeking a safe gambling experience, letting them engage confidently in their favorite games.

Check Licensing Data

How can players ensure they are dealing with a trustworthy online casino? One of the most essential steps is to check the licensing information of the casino. Licensed online casinos work under particular regulations defined by governing authorities, guaranteeing fair play and player protection. Players should check for licenses issued by established jurisdictions,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ission. This information is typically shown prominently on the casino's website. Additionally, players can check the authenticity of the license by visiting the respective regulatory body's website. A transparent and easily accessible licensing section demonstrates a commitment to security and compliance, enhancing players' confidence in their gaming experience. Always choose licensed platforms for a safe online gambling environment.

Protected Payment Solutions

Although numerous players pursue thrills in internet gambling, the importance of selecting secure payment options cannot be overstated. Secure approaches like credit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ers give players confidence in their safety. Credit cards, to illustrate, commonly feature fraud defense mechanisms, boosting security for transactions. E-wallets like copyright and Skrill allow users to deposit and withdraw funds without sharing sensitive bank details, minimizing risk. Furthermore, digital currencies are becoming popular due to their privacy and security features, providing a contemporary option. Players are encouraged to look for online casinos that utilize SSL encryption and comply with industry regulations, ensuring a secure gaming environment. Opting for trustworthy payment alternatives greatly enriches the entire online gambling journey, securing players' fiscal details.

High Risk Processing Methods

Maneuvering the landscape of online gambling payment methods reveals a significant contrast between safe and risky options. High-risk payment methods, such as wire transfers and certain cryptocurrencies, often lack the security features that protect users' financial information. These methods can expose players to fraudulent activities, money laundering, or chargebacks, leading to potential losses. Additionally, unregulated payment processors may not offer sufficient customer support or dispute resolution, leaving users vulnerable. In contrast, safer alternatives, including e-wallets and credit cards, provide additional layers of security and buyer protection. Players are advised to thoroughly research payment methods, prioritizing those with robust encryption and regulatory oversight. This diligence helps ensure a secure online gambling experience, minimizing risks associated with financial transactions.

Tips for Players to Strengthen Their Online Security

To improve their online security, players should embrace a proactive approach by putting into practice several key strategies. First, it is vital to use strong, unique passwords for each gaming account, incorporating a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ters. Dual-factor authentication (copyright) can provide an extra layer of protection, requiring a second form of verification.

Players should also guarantee their devices are equipped with current antivirus software to guard against malicious attacks. Routinely checking account statements for unauthorized transactions can help detect any suspicious activity early. Additionally, leveraging a secure internet connection, such as a VPN, can secure personal data from potential hackers.

Last but not least, gamblers need to familiarize themselves with the gaming site's security safeguards, such as encryption technologies and privacy guidelines, to guarantee a protected gaming experience. By adhering to these guidelines, players can considerably improve their online security whilst experiencing their favorite games.
